More students of Sainik school suspected of food poisoning

The death of a class VI student at Sainik School, Amaravathi Nagar Udumalpet has pushed the school to close down till 24th July. 

It is suspected that he died out of food poisoning, he collapsed at the breakfast session on Friday and was rushed to the Udumalpet Government hospital, where he was declared dead.

The parents outraged that the school authorities have not communicated to them about his fever, they also demonstrated a sit-in protest at the Palani-Pollachi road alleging the school authorities. 

An apprehensive state prevailed as 24 students complained of similar ailment and were rushed to nearby hospitals, blood samples were collected from them for further investigation. 

Shortly, five more students were also admitted at a private hospital in Coimbatore suspected of food poisoning.

The authorities are awaiting the autopsy report to ascertain the reason behind Siddharth's death.
